    As an expert in the field of environmental science, I'm delighted to delve into the fascinating topic of negative ions. Negative ions, scientifically known as anions, are oxygen ions that have gained an extra electron. This additional electron endows them with a negative charge, which is the key to their numerous health benefits and their ability to improve air quality.

    The production of negative ions is a natural process that occurs in various environments. They are most abundant near bodies of water, such as rivers, streams, and the sea, due to the process of water molecules ionizing under the influence of solar radiation, friction, or even the energy from waterfalls. When water molecules split, they release oxygen ions that capture free electrons, thus becoming negatively charged.

    In addition to natural water sources, negative ions can also be produced through other natural phenomena. For instance, during thunderstorms, the electrical discharges in the atmosphere can generate negative ions. Similarly, the friction caused by the movement of trees in the wind can also result in the ionization of air molecules, releasing oxygen ions with extra electrons.

    Moreover, certain minerals, such as tourmaline and some types of crystals, are known to emit negative ions when subjected to heat or pressure. This property has led to the incorporation of these minerals in various consumer products, from air purifiers to wearable accessories, with the aim of enhancing the ion content in the surrounding environment.

    The presence of negative ions has been linked to a range of health benefits, including improved mood, reduced stress, and enhanced immune function. They are believed to neutralize positive ions, which are often associated with pollutants and allergens, thereby purifying the air and promoting a healthier living environment.

    In summary, the production of negative ions is a natural and multifaceted process that occurs in various natural settings and can also be artificially induced through certain materials and conditions. Their abundance near fresh, flowing water and their potential health benefits make them an intriguing subject of study in the field of environmental science.
